Finding Scholarships

The best way to find scholarships is to do some research. Check out websites like ScholarshipExperts.com and FastWeb.com to find scholarships that you might be eligible for.

You can also ask your school counselor or teachers if they know of any scholarships that you might be able to apply for. And don’t forget to check with any organizations that you or your parents are a part of, like churches, clubs, and businesses.

Applying for Scholarships

Once you’ve found some scholarships that you think you might be eligible for, it’s time to start applying! Make sure to fill out all the required paperwork accurately and completely, and double-check for any typos or mistakes.

You may also need to write an essay or provide letters of recommendation. Make sure to give yourself enough time to write an essay that stands out and shows why you deserve the scholarship.
